As a Material Technician, you are an essential member of the team responsible for ensuring the quality, safety, and integrity of construction materials used in various projects. Your role involves conducting tests, analyzing data, and providing technical expertise to support the selection, handling, and application of materials such as soils, aggregates, concrete, asphalt, and other construction-related materials. With your attention to detail, analytical skills, and commitment to quality assurance, you contribute to the successful completion of construction projects while upholding industry standards and regulatory requirements.

- Conducting material field testing such as field compaction testing, hot mix asphalt sampling, and asphalt coring, as part of QC/QA programs.
- Conducting occasional wet concrete sampling.
- Working in field laboratories completing quality assurance or quality control testing for grading, base or paving projects.
- Using nuclear gauges to confirm density and moisture of granular base.
- Determining asphalt density, asphalt content and gradation.
- Keeping accurate daily journals of construction activities and testing programs.
- Testing results reporting using standardized forms and reports.
